版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
DATE\@"yyyy-MM-dd"2009-09-22Version1.0PAGE1联芯科技ERP项目 DATE\@"M/d/yyyy"9/22/2009Version1.0 联芯科技ERP项目开发规格书第I部分:需求模块MACROBUTTONCheckIt_CheckBox£MM ■PP MACROBUTTONCheckIt_CheckBox£SD MACROBUTTONCheckIt_CheckBox£FI MACROBUTTONCheckIt_CheckBox£CO MACROBUTTONCheckIt_CheckBox£IP/FMMACROBUTTONCheckIt_CheckBox£其它Spec编号ZLC_PP_013短描述委外生产任务情况报表类型MACROBUTTONUnCheckIt_Radiobutton报表●ABAPProgramMACROBUTTONCheckIt_RadiobuttonInformationSystemMACROBUTTONCheckIt_RadiobuttonReportPrinter MACROBUTTONCheckIt_RadiobuttonReportWriterMACROBUTTONCheckIt_RadiobuttonSAPQueryMACROBUTTONCheckIt_RadiobuttonBWreportMACROBUTTONCheckIt_RadiobuttonCrystalReportsMACROBUTTONCheckIt_RadiobuttonOthersMACROBUTTONCheckIt_Radiobutton表单MACROBUTTONCheckIt_Radiobutton流程增强MACROBUTTONCheckIt_RadiobuttonUserExitMACROBUTTONCheckIt_RadiobuttonBADIMACROBUTTONCheckIt_RadiobuttonDialogProgram MACROBUTTONCheckIt_RadiobuttonOtherseMACROBUTTONCheckIt_Radiobutton接口MACROBUTTONCheckIt_RadiobuttonBAPIMACROBUTTONCheckIt_RadiobuttonIDOCMACROBUTTONCheckIt_RadiobuttonALEMACROBUTTONCheckIt_RadiobuttonOthersendMACROBUTTONCheckIt_Radiobutton数据转移需求优先级MACROBUTTONCheckIt_RadiobuttonHigh/关键 MACROBUTTONUnCheckIt_RadiobuttonMid/推荐 MACROBUTTONCheckIt_RadiobuttonLow/可选用户MACROBUTTONNextCell王董豹要求日期集成测试时使用预计开发天数_4__天是否有标准功能MACROBUTTONCheckIt_RadiobuttonYes MACROBUTTONUnCheckIt_RadiobuttonNo标准功能未采用的原因:MACROBUTTONCheckIt_RadiobuttonPerformanceMACROBUTTONCheckIt_RadiobuttonComplexityMACROBUTTONCheckIt_RadiobuttonOtherse参考的标准功能文档变更历史版本号文档维护时间姓名简要的描述V1.02009-0朱辉明V1.12009-07-02王董豹将数量改为计划数量,增加在产数量、成品率字段20090908徐世兵增加技术说明文档
第II部分:详细功能描述目的:跟踪检查委外生产任务的执行情况功能描述:查询系统内的委外生产任务的计划情况以及实际执行情况。计划数量、BOM版本、软件版本、实际入库的数量与实际入库的日期。运行频率MACROBUTTONUnCheckIt_Radiobutton任何时间MACROBUTTONCheckIt_Radiobutton每天MACROBUTTONCheckIt_Radiobutton每周MACROBUTTONCheckIt_Radiobutton两周MACROBUTTONCheckIt_Radiobutton每月MACROBUTTONCheckIt_Radiobutton每年MACROBUTTONCheckIt_Radiobutton其它:运行方式MACROBUTTONUnCheckIt_Radiobutton手工MACROBUTTONCheckIt_Radiobutton自动MACROBUTTONCheckIt_Radiobutton批处理MACROBUTTONCheckIt_Radiobutton在线处理输出方式MACROBUTTONCheckIt_Radiobutton屏幕输出MACROBUTTONCheckIt_Radiobutton打印MACROBUTTONUnCheckIt_Radiobutton文件输出MACROBUTTONCheckIt_Radiobutton其它:打印机类型(如无特殊需求,预设为激光打印机)纸张大小(如无特殊需求,预设为A4横印)语言(如无特殊需求,预设为中文)选择屏幕: 工厂:FromXXXXXXTOXXXXXX(1)产品编号:FromXXXXXXTOXXXXXX(2)MRP控制者:FromXXXXXXTOXXXXXX(2)委外PR单号:FromXXXXXXTOXXXXXX(3)委外PO单号:FromXXXXXXTOXXXXXX(4)PO建立日期:FromXXXXXXTOXXXXXX(5)计划交货日期:FromXXXXXXTOXXXXXX(6)实际交货日期:FromXXXXXXTOXXXXXX(6)采购申请类型:可选:顺序字段名称字段技术名称字段描述特殊需求1工厂EKPO-WERKS工厂2产品编号EKPO-MATNR3MRP控制者MARC-DISPO4委外PR单号EKPO-BANFN委外采购申请单号5委外PO
单号EKPO-EBELN委外采购单号6PO建立日期EKKO-AEDAT7计划交货日期EKET-EINDT8实际交货日期MKPF-BUDAT9BSARTEBAN-BSART采购申请类型报表/表单的字段功能顾问(必填)列出报表或自定义打印程序上选择屏幕上的字段显示名称(在屏幕或单据上的名称)技术名称(字段的来源信息,如果有默认值或需要计算,也需要列出)描述(字段的业务含义,包括的内容等,例:标准salesorder—所有类型为OR的订单)特殊需求(如需要加入英文注释)例:顺序字段名称字段技术名称字段描述特殊需求1IDID序号序号从1累加2WERKSEKPO-WERKS工厂编码根据查询的单据选取工厂3EBELNEKPO-EBELN委外PO单号4EBELPEKPO-EBELP项目编号5MATNREKPO-MATNR产品编号6MAKTXMAKT-MAKTX产品名称7DISPOMARC-DISPOMRP控制者8PLIFZMARC-PLIFZ计划交货时间9PO建立日期10LIFNREKKO-LIFNR委外加工商11NAME1LFA1-NAME1供应商名称12BANFNEKPO-BANFN委外采购申请单号13BSARTEBAN-BSART采购申请类型14MENGEEKET-MENGE计划数量已计划数量15BADATEKET-EINDT计划交货日期16在产数量在产数量=EKET-MENGE-EKET-WEMNG-MSEC-MENGE17VERIDEKET-VERIDBOM版本统计字段18软件版本读取采购订单文本信息中的软件版本19WEMNGEKET-WEMNG交货数量合计每单的(EKET-WEMNG)合计20成品率21MENGEMSEC-MENGE质检数量合计每单的全部103收货合计-每单的(EKET-WEMNG)合计22MBLNRMSEG-MBLNR交货单号23BUDATMKPF-BUDAT交货日期过账日期24MENGEMSEC-MENGE交货数量移动类型为:105,10625MENGEMSEC-MENGE冻结数量移动类型为:103,10426LGORTMSEG-LGORT交货仓库27BWARTMSEG-BWART移动类型25BANFNEKPO-BANFN采购申请单号格式/屏幕设计:必填报表和单据列出纸张附件名(必填)附上Excel/Word附件。(如附檔XXXXXXXX.XLS/或附表XXXX单)(必填)屏幕截图样张:列出业务单据编号附上样张的WORD/EXCEL文件其它内容:对报表/单据的其它功能进行描述*注:删除上面不适用的行和注释行.
第III部分:技术说明ProgramnameZ_PP_EXEC_EXEC_SCHEDULETransactioncodeZPP010AuthorizationObjectFormFormnameN/AOutputtypeN/AFormroutineN/A程序逻辑:要求:ALV输出,能够导入到EXCEL。逻辑关系:1,可以输入多个采购申请编号2,可以输入多个采购订单编号EKET关联EKPOEKET-EBELN;EKET-EBELPEKPO-EBELN;EKPO-EBELPEKKO关联EKPOEKPO-EBELN;EKKO-EBELNMSEG关联EKPOMSEG-EBELN;MSEG-EBELPEKPO-EBELN;EKPO-EBELPMSEG关联MKPFMSEG-MBLNR;MKPF-MBLNR委外采购订单:必须符合EKPO-PSTYP=3并排除EKPO-LOEKZ=XEKKO关联LFA1EKKO-LIFNR与LFA1-LIFNR备注信息:一张订单可以存在多个交货日期与交货数量,一张订单可以存在多个交货单号。必须把所有的交货明细列出。交货计划与交货单号不是一一对应关系。在产数量:在产数量=EKET-MENGE-EKET-WEMNG-MSEC-MENGE;成品率:成品率=100*(取MSEG-BWART=105,106,且MSEG-LGORT=1030,1020的∑MSEC-MENGE)/(EKET-WEMNG(交货数量合计)+MSEC-MENGE(质检数量合计))取数PERFORMGET_DATA.1.1从EKKO,EKPO取采购订单的主要信息1.2从EKBE读取采购订单历史相关信息SELECTBELNRASMBLNR"交货凭证号BWART"移动类型BUDAT"凭证日期WESBSASMENGE"数量EBELN"采购单号EBELP"采购行项目号GJAHR"凭证年度BUZEI"凭证项目号INTOCORRESPONDINGFIELDSOFTABLELT_EKBEFROMEKBEFORALLENTRIESINGT_OUTWHEREEBELN=GT_OUT-EBELNANDEBELP=GT_OUT-EBELPANDBWARTIN('103','104','105','106').1.3按订单号和行项目号进行交货历史的汇总,计算出已交货数量SORTLT_EKBEBYEBELNEBELP.LOOPATLT_EKBEINTOLS_EKBE.IFLS_EKBE-BWART='105'.LS_EKBE-MENGE=ABS(LS_EKBE-MENGE).ELSEIFLS_EKBE-BWART='106'ORLS_EKBE-BWART='122'.LS_EKBE-MENGE=ABS(LS_EKBE-MENGE)*-1.ENDIF.IFLS_EKBE-BWART='105'ORLS_EKBE-BWART='106'ORLS_EKBE-BWART='122'.G_SUM=G_SUM+LS_EKBE-MENGE.ENDIF.ATENDOFEBELP.READTABLELT_EKBEINTOLS_EKBEINDEXSY-TABIX.LS_105-EBELN=LS_EKBE-EBELN.LS_105-EBELP=LS_EKBE-EBELP.LS_105-SUMMENGE=G_SUM.APPENDLS_105TOLT_105.CLEAR:G_SUM,LS_105.ENDAT.CLEAR:LS_EKBE.ENDLOOP.读取交货计划行信息SELECTEBELN "采购单号EBELP "采购行项目号EINDTASBADAT "计划交货日期VERID "BOM版本ETENR"交货计划行计数器INTOTABLELT_EKETFROMEKETFORALLENTRIESINGT_OUTWHEREEBELN=GT_OUT-EBELNANDEBELP=GT_OUT-EBELPANDEKET~EINDTINS_EINDT.1.5进行数据处理,合并计算相关数据LOOPATGT_OUTINTOGS_OUT.*取交货数量合计SELECTSUM(WEMNG)SUM(MENGE)INTO(GS_OUT-WEMNG,GS_OUT-SUMMENGE)FROMEKETWHEREEBELN=GS_OUT-EBELNANDEBELP=GS_OUT-EBELP.*取103/104合计CLEAR:GT_SUM103,GT_SUM104.SELECTSUM(WESBS)INTOGT_SUM103FROMEKBEWHEREEBELN=GS_OUT-EBELNANDEBELP=GS_OUT-EBELPANDBWART='103'.SELECTSUM(WESBS)INTOGT_SUM104FROMEKBEWHEREEBELN=GS_OUT-EBELNANDEBELP=GS_OUT-EBELPANDBWART='104'.*每单的全部103/104收货合计-每单的(EKET-WEMNG)合计GS_OUT-C_MENGE=ABS(GT_SUM103)-ABS(GT_SUM104)-GS_OUT-WEMNG."质检数量合计*计算在产数量(在产数量=EKET-MENGE-EKET-WEMNG-MSEC-MENGE)GS_OUT-ZZAICHAN=GS_OUT-SUMMENGE-GS_OUT-WEMNG-GS_OUT-C_MENGE.*取版本号CLEAR:L_TEXT.CONCATENATEGS_OUT-EBELNGS_OUT-EBELPINTOL_TEXT.CALLFUNCTION'READ_TEXT'EXPORTINGCLIENT=SY-MANDTID='F91'"采购申请的长文本软件版本ID号(见表TTXID)LANGUAGE='1'"语言NAME=L_TEXT"采购申请号+采购申请行项目号OBJECT='EKPO'"采购申请的应用程序对象(见表TTXID)TABLESLINES=LT_TLINE"输出的长文本表EXCEPTIONSID=1LANGUAGE=2NAME=3NOT_FOUND=4OBJECT=5REFERENCE_CHECK=6WRONG_ACCESS_TO_ARCHIVE=7OTHERS=8.LOOPATLT_TLINE.CONCATENATELT_TLINE-TDLINEGS_OUT-VERTEXTINTOGS_OUT-VERTEXT.ENDLOOP.1.6进行输出内表处理,按交货计划、和交货历史进行比较,以同一订单号行项目号二者条数多的为基数进行输出1.7整理后的输出内表进行相关计算处理输出表整理LOOPATGT_OUT2INTOGS_OUT2.IFGS_OUT2-BWART='122'."122移动类型用做计算成品率不做输出DELETEGT_OUT2.CONTINUE.ENDIF.*输出序号处理L_ID=L_ID+1.GS_OUT2-ID=L_ID.*成品率计算READTABLELT_105INTOLS_105WITHKEYEBELN=GS_OUT2-EBELNEBELP=GS_OUT2-EBELP.IFSY-SUBRC=0ANDGS_OUT2-WEMNG<>0."成品率=100*(∑105/106)/(交货数量合计)GS_OUT2-ZCPL=(100*LS_105-SUMMENGE)/GS_OUT2-WEMNG.ENDIF.*数量去小数点GS_OUT2-MENGE105I=GS_OUT2-MENGE105.GS_OUT2-MENGE103I=GS_OUT2-MENGE103.GS_OUT2-E_MENGEI=GS_OUT2-E_MENGE."已计划数量GS_OUT2-WEMNGI=GS_OUT2-WEMNG."交货数量合计GS_OUT2
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 西南医科大学《卫生事业管理学》2022-2023学年第一学期期末试卷
- 西南医科大学《动物与中外文学》2021-2022学年第一学期期末试卷
- 西南林业大学《后期包装特效设计实践》2023-2024学年第一学期期末试卷
- 2024年01月11291教育学期末试题答案
- 安全生产月事故案例分析
- 西华大学《技术与应用双语》2021-2022学年第一学期期末试卷
- 西安邮电大学《无线传感器网络》2022-2023学年第一学期期末试卷
- My family幼儿园家庭成员介绍手抄报
- 《光辐射与发光源》课件
- 《大数据解决方案》课件
- 小学生学业成绩等级制度-小学学业等级
- 过程审核VDA6.3检查表
- 常压矩形容器设计计算软件
- 交流变换为直流的稳定电源设计方案
- PR6C系列数控液压板料折弯机 使用说明书
- 装配工艺通用要求
- 钢结构工程环境保护和文明施工措施
- 物业管理业主意见征询表
- 8D培训课件 (ppt 43页)
- 劳动力计划表
- 《教育改革发展纲要》义务教育阶段解读
评论
0/150
提交评论